The Significance of Wagering Requirements
Wagering requirements are arguably the most important aspect to consider when evaluating a casino bonus. A 30x wagering requirement, for example, means that if you receive a $100 bonus, you must wager $3,000 before you can withdraw any winnings derived from that bonus. Higher wagering requirements make it significantly more challenging to convert the bonus into real cash. Beyond the wagering requirement itself, it’s also important to check the validity period of the bonus. Bonuses typically have an expiration date, and any unused bonus funds or unfulfilled wagering requirements will be forfeited. A reasonable validity period provides ample time to meet the conditions. A careful assessment of these factors ensures that bonus offers are truly beneficial and not merely marketing ploys.

Responsible Gaming and Player Support
A reputable online casino prioritizes responsible gaming and provides comprehensive support resources for players who may be struggling with gambling-related issues. This includes offering tools for self-exclusion, deposit limits, and time restrictions. Self-exclusion allows players to voluntarily ban themselves from the platform for a specified period. Deposit limits enable players to set daily, weekly, or monthly spending limits. Time restrictions help players monitor and control the amount of time they spend gambling. Furthermore, the casino should provide links to external support organizations that offer assistance and guidance. A commitment to responsible gaming demonstrates a genuine concern for the well-being of its players. Robust player support is also essential, offering assistance with technical issues, account management, and any other concerns.
